Hyundai Elantra (CN7): Front Seat / Front Seat Frame Assembly

Components and components location

Component Location

1. Front seat back frame assembly
2. Front seat cushion frame assembly

Repair procedures

Replacement
   
•
Put on gloves to prevent hand injuries.
   
•
When removing with a flat - tip screwdriver or remover, wrap protective tape around the tools to prevent damage to components.
•
Use a plastic panel removal tool to remove interior trim pieces without marring the surface.
•
Take care not to bend or scratch the trim and panels.
1.
Remove the front seat back cover.
(Refer to Front Seat - "Front Seat Back Cover")
2.
Remove the front seat cushion cover.
(Refer to Front Seat - "Front Seat Cushion Cover")
3.
Remove the side airbag (SAB) module.
(Refer to Airbag Module - "Side Airbag (SAB) Module")
4.
Remove the lumbar support assembly.
(Refer to Body Electrical System - "Lumbar Support Unit")
5.
After loosening the mounting bolts, detach the front seat back frame assembly (A) from the front seat cushion frame assembly (B).
Tightening torque :
44.1 - 53.9 N.m (4.5 - 5.5 kgf.m, 32.5 - 39.8 lb-ft)

6.
To install, reverse the removal procedure.
   
•
For the seat equipped with side airbag, remove the side airbag from the seat frame assembly.
(Refer to Restraint - "Side Airbag (SAB) Module")
•
Before service, be fully aware of precautions and service procedure relevant to air bag.
(Refer to Restraint - "Side Airbag (SAB) Module")
